JS抓取网页的10种方法与技巧,快速获取所需信息

优采云 发布时间: 2023-03-06 07:11

  在互联网时代,信息的获取是我们每天都要面对的问题。但是,有时候我们需要的信息并不是那么容易获取。这时候,JS抓取网页成为了一种非常实用的技能。本文将从10个方面详细介绍JS抓取网页的方法和技巧,帮助大家轻松获取所需信息。

  1. JS基础知识

  在学习JS抓取网页前,我们需要先掌握JS基础知识。包括变量、数据类型、运算符、流程控制语句、函数等。只有掌握了这些基础知识,才能更好地理解后面的内容。

  2. HTTP请求

  在JS抓取网页中,我们需要用到HTTP请求。HTTP请求是指客户端向服务器发送请求,并从服务器接收响应的过程。具体来说,就是通过GET或POST方法向服务器发送请求,然后服务器返回响应结果。

  3. AJAX技术

  

  AJAX技术可以实现异步加载数据,避免页面重载。在JS抓取网页中,使用AJAX技术可以更加快速地获取所需信息。

  4. 爬虫原理

  爬虫是指通过程序自动访问网站并提取数据的过程。在JS抓取网页中,我们可以使用爬虫来获取大量数据。

  5. 正则表达式

  正则表达式是一种用于匹配字符串模式的工具。在JS抓取网页中,我们可以使用正则表达式来匹配所需信息。

  

  6. jQuery库

  jQuery库是一个JavaScript库,它简化了HTML文档遍历和操作、事件处理、*敏*感*词*效果等操作。在JS抓取网页中,使用jQuery库可以更加方便地操作DOM元素。

  7. PhantomJS框架

  PhantomJS框架是一个基于WebKit引擎的无界面浏览器。它可以模拟浏览器行为,并且支持JavaScript、CSS、DOM等标准特性。在JS抓取网页中,使用PhantomJS框架可以更加方便地进行自动化测试和爬虫操作。

  8. Selenium框架

  

  Selenium框架是一种自动化测试工具,它支持多种浏览器,并且可以直接与浏览器交互。在JS抓取网页中,使用Selenium框架可以更加方便地进行自动化测试和爬虫操作。

  9. 反爬虫技巧

  反爬虫技巧是指防止被爬虫程序访问和采集数据的技巧。在JS抓取网页中,我们需要了解一些反爬虫技巧,并且注意不要违反相关法律法规。

  10. JS抓取实战案例

  最后,在本文中我们将给出一些实战案例来演示如何使用JS抓取网页。这些案例包括:抓取天气预报信息、获取股票行情数据、采集淘宝商品信息等。

  总结:

  本文详细介绍了如何使用JS抓取网页,并从10个方面进行了详细讲解。希望读者能够通过本文学会如何轻松获取所需信息。同时也推荐大家使用优采云进行SEO优化工作,优采云(www.ucaiyun.com)作为国内领先的SEO服务商,在SEO优化方面拥有丰富经验和专业团队,能够为企业提供最佳SEO解决方案。

0 个评论

要回复文章请先登录注册


官方客服QQ群

微信人工客服

QQ人工客服


线